Tailah Girl
Name Meaning & Origin Pronunciation: TAY-lah /ˈteɪ.lə/
Origin: Hebrew; Arabic
Meaning: Hebrew: dew; Arabic: a form of the name Talha
Historical & Cultural Background
The name Tailah has roots in Hebrew, derived from the word "tal," meaning "dew." This etymological origin reflects a connection to nature, as dew is often associated with freshness and renewal. U.S. Historical Usage
The name Tailah was first seen in the United States in 1997.
Tailah has ranked as high as #21849 nationally, which occurred in 2003, and has been most popular in .
In the past 5 years the name Tailah has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.

Popularity Over Time (National) — Table
We track the national popularity of each baby name annually. The table below displays each year along with the number of births reported by the Social Security Administration. This data combines all state-level reporting from the SSA's baby names database to provide a comprehensive view of overall birth counts for Tailah.
| Year | Total Births | Girl |
|---|---|---|
| 2015 | 5 | 5 |
| 2014 | 5 | 5 |
| 2009 | 6 | 6 |
| 2005 | 6 | 6 |
| 2003 | 6 | 6 |
| 1997 | 5 | 5 |
